Hey, I caught a game between Finland and the Czech Rep. on tv yesterday, and the Finnish team had a ton of players from the NHL in this game. It is the norm that if your team doesn't make the playoffs, you go play in the IIHF stuff for a while? There was a player from the Bruins, one from Florida, and Tuomo Ruutu of the Blackhawks. I wonder if it makes the team chemistry weird, having to play alongside some of your opposition in the NHL :blink:

That is what happens in the Olympics playing for your country. I think there is more pride playing with your country men than playing for an NHL team. Think of Team Sweden in Turin. That may be Sundin's greatest championship experience.

Even as teams get eliminated from the playoffs, if the tournament is still going on, they'll join their country's team for the remainder. I agree with DS that most guys take more pride in playing for your country, especially for europeans.
